/** Premier userinterface.scss  **/
.store_locator_plus #slp_loader_div {
  position: relative;
  margin: 0;
  padding: 0; }
  .store_locator_plus #slp_loader_div .loader_box {
    position: absolute;
    z-index: 1000;
    margin: 0 auto;
    width: 100%;
    height: 50px;
    display: none; }
    .store_locator_plus #slp_loader_div .loader_box .loader {
      position: relative;
      margin: 0 auto;
      width: 50px;
      height: 50px;
      border-radius: 50%;
      -webkit-animation: spin 2s linear infinite;
      animation: spin 2s linear infinite;
      border: 5px solid #F5F5F5;
      border-top-color: #2196F3; }
      .store_locator_plus #slp_loader_div .loader_box .loader.red_light_grey {
        border-top-color: #F44336; }
      .store_locator_plus #slp_loader_div .loader_box .loader.blue_light_grey {
        border-top-color: #2196F3; }
      .store_locator_plus #slp_loader_div .loader_box .loader.teal_light_grey {
        border-top-color: #009688; }
      .store_locator_plus #slp_loader_div .loader_box .loader.green_light_grey {
        border-top-color: #4CAF50; }
      .store_locator_plus #slp_loader_div .loader_box .loader.yellow_light_grey {
        border-top-color: #FFEB3B; }
      .store_locator_plus #slp_loader_div .loader_box .loader.amber_light_grey {
        border-top-color: #FFC107; }
      .store_locator_plus #slp_loader_div .loader_box .loader.grey_light_grey {
        border-top-color: #9E9E9E; }
      .store_locator_plus #slp_loader_div .loader_box .loader.dark_light_grey {
        border-top-color: #424242; }
@-webkit-keyframes spin {
  0% {
    -webkit-transform: rotate(0deg); }
  100% {
    -webkit-transform: rotate(360deg); } }
@keyframes spin {
  0% {
    transform: rotate(0deg); }
  100% {
    transform: rotate(360deg); } }
.store_locator_plus .search_item.category .category.checklist {
  margin: 0;
  padding: 0;
  list-style-type: none;
  width: 100%;
  display: flex;
  flex-wrap: wrap;
  justify-content: space-between; }
  .store_locator_plus .search_item.category .category.checklist.horizontal {
    flex-direction: row; }
    .store_locator_plus .search_item.category .category.checklist.horizontal li {
      flex: 0 1 auto; }
  .store_locator_plus .search_item.category .category.checklist.vertical {
    flex-direction: column;
    width: 100%; }
    .store_locator_plus .search_item.category .category.checklist.vertical li {
      flex: 1 1 auto; }

div#map .slp_info_bubble .woo_buy_block span {
  display: block; }

#map_sidebar .results_pagination {
  margin: 0.5em 0;
  text-align: right; }
  #map_sidebar .results_pagination a {
    text-decoration: none;
    border: none; }
#map_sidebar div.woo_buy_block {
  display: block;
  width: 100%; }
  #map_sidebar div.woo_buy_block span {
    display: block; }
    #map_sidebar div.woo_buy_block span.woo_product_title {
      font-weight: bold; }
    #map_sidebar div.woo_buy_block span.woo_price {
      color: #60646c;
      font-weight: 400; }
    #map_sidebar div.woo_buy_block span.woo_buy_link {
      background-color: #60646c;
      padding: 0.618em 1em; }
      #map_sidebar div.woo_buy_block span.woo_buy_link A {
        color: white;
        text-decoration: none;
        text-align: center; }

/*# sourceMappingURL=userinterface.css.map */
